Jane Skinner, Fox News anchor finally bid goodbye to the network after 12 years of service.

Skinner, who is married to NFL Commissioner Roger Goodell, joined FOx News as a general assignment reporter in 1998. Skinner was co-hosting Happening Now with Jon Scott from 11 a.m. to 1 p.m. ET.

She announced on-air Thursday that it was her last day on Fox and it was thrill for her to be part of the News Team.

“This is my last day on the air at Fox,” she said. “It’s been a thrill to have been a part of the incredible success of this place over the past 12 years that I’ve been here. My life in the 12 years I have been here has changed significantly in wonderful ways and they’ve created a lot of new responsibilities. I added a husband who has in the last couple of years become the NFL commissioner, and has a job even busier than mine. I have twin daughters, so to do justice to this new life I’ve decided to take a break from the business.”

It maybe sad for other people but for Skinner, it would be the best for her family.
